Modula-2[1,2] grew out of a practical need for a general, efficiently implementable, systems programming language. Its ancestors are Pascal[3] and Modula[4]. From the latter, it has inherited the name, the important module concept, and a systematic, modern syntax; from Pascal, most of the rest. This includes in particular the data structures, i.e. arrays, records, variant records, sets, and pointers. Structured statements include the familiar IF, CASE, REPEAT, WHILE, FOR, and WITH statements.

Topaz is an experimental distributed computing environment programmed in Modula-2+, which supports garbage collection. Topaz has been in daily use by about 50 researchers at SRC since 1986. The Modula-2+ garbage collector is concurrent; it combines reference-counting and mark-and-sweep collection.
